Day 12 - Barauli, Nepal
During the morning we walked through the town before taking a safari in Chitwan National Park. This park is home to Sloth bears, crocodiles, monkeys, rhinos and tigers. We saw some bambi deer and a boar but the highlight was the rhino next to the river. Unfortunately no tigers. When driving through the small towns children everywhere waved to us in such excitment. In the evening we were treated with traditional dances were we also participated. It was a wonderful experience. Tomorrow we head to Pokhara but it will be a long trip due to the poor condition of roads due to the floods.
